Valentina Peleggi is Music Director of the Richmond Symphony.  Described by the BBC Music Magazine as a “rising star,” Valentina has led orchestras from around the world, including the Royal Philharmonic Orchestra, BBC National Orchestra of Wales, and the Baltimore Symphony Orchestra, and will shortly release her first CD on Naxos.

Originally from Florence, Valentina was the first Italian woman to enter the conducting program at the Royal Academy of Music in London, and more recently was honored with the title of Associate. Currently Guest Music Director with the Theatro São Pedro in São Paulo, Brazil, Valentina was Mackerras Fellow with the English National Opera from 2018 – 2020 and previously served as Resident Conductor of the São Paulo Symphony Orchestra and Principal Conductor and Artistic Advisor of their professional symphonic chorus. She won the 2014 Conducting Prize at the Festival Internacional de Inverno Campos do Jordão, a Bruno Walter Foundation Scholarship at the Cabrillo Festival of Contemporary Music in California, and the Taki Concordia Conducting Fellowship 2015 – 2017 under Marin Alsop.
